Answering the initial question, though. We like to call ourselves Premium Indie. We are not 3 guys sitting in a basement and coding (nothing against them, we LOVE the indie spirit!) - we have about 90 employees right now, we are not only developing but also publishing games - it wouldn't be fair to call us "indie" anymore.

Would I call Frostpunk an indie game? Not in terms of technological or mechanical solutions. It's a complex game, full of quality stuff. But I would say that it is indie at heart. Why? We believe it's fresh, it twists the genre, it offers something totally new. It's quite risky to make this kind of game, to be honest. And for us - usually "indie" games take this kind of risks (again, we love AAA titles as well - but they tend to play it safe quite often).
